Hurricane fence installation typically involves the design, placement, and securing of durable fencing materials that can withstand severe weather conditions associated with hurricanes. This work often includes assessing the property’s layout, selecting appropriate fencing styles and materials, and ensuring proper anchoring to resist high winds and storm surges. Property owners should consider the specific challenges posed by their local climate and terrain when planning for a hurricane fence, as these factors influence the scope of work and the types of materials that are most effective.

Clearly defining the scope of hurricane fence installation is essential to ensure the project meets safety and durability expectations. A detailed scope helps property owners and contractors agree on the extent of work, such as the length and height of the fence, the types of materials used, and any additional features like gates or reinforcement. Having these details in writing minimizes misunderstandings, provides clarity on responsibilities, and helps ensure that the final installation aligns with the property owner’s needs and local building considerations.

How To Compare Local Pros

When evaluating contractors for hurricane fence installation, it is important to consider their experience with similar projects. Contractors who have a proven track record of installing fences in hurricane-prone areas are more likely to understand the unique challenges involved, such as high winds and storm resistance requirements. Asking for details about past projects can help determine whether a service provider has the relevant expertise and familiarity with the specific demands of hurricane-resistant fencing. This insight can contribute to making an informed decision about which local contractors are equipped to handle the scope of the work effectively.

A clear, written scope of work is essential when comparing potential service providers. The scope should outline the specific tasks involved, materials to be used, and any relevant standards or specifications. Having a detailed description helps ensure that expectations are aligned and reduces the risk of misunderstandings. When reviewing proposals or estimates, look for contractors who provide comprehensive written documentation that clearly defines what will be done, rather than vague or general statements. This clarity supports a smoother project process and helps set realistic expectations from the outset.
